Understanding “Instant” in the Australian Casino Landscape

When Aussie players type “instant withdrawals” into a search engine they usually imagine money appearing in their bank account within minutes. In reality the term is a bit of marketing fluff – most casinos can’t bypass the banking network entirely, but they can shave hours or days off the normal processing time.

Australian law requires online gambling operators to conduct a KYC (Know Your Customer) check before any money moves out. That step alone can add a few business hours, especially if the casino needs to verify identity documents. The good news is that many licensed sites have streamlined the process so that, once you’re fully verified, the next withdrawal request is often processed “instantly” on their end, even if the final leg to your wallet takes a bit longer.

Top Payment Methods That Offer the Fastest Payouts

Not all deposit and withdrawal routes are created equal. Below is a quick look at the most common Australian‑friendly methods and how they stack up when you’re after a rapid cash‑out.

Payment Method Average Withdrawal Time Typical Fees
POLi Payments 30 minutes – 2 hours AU$0–AU$2
PayPal (where supported) Instant to 1 hour AU$0–AU$3
Credit / Debit Card (Visa, Mastercard) 1 hour – 24 hours AU$0–AU$5
Bank Transfer (BPay, Direct Deposit) 24 hours – 48 hours AU$0–AU$5
E‑wallets (Neteller, Skrill) Instant – 30 minutes AU$0–AU$4

If you’re after the quickest possible payout, set up an e‑wallet or POLi account before you even start playing. Those two usually beat traditional bank transfers by a long shot, especially when the casino processes the request automatically.

Licensing and Regulation – Why They Matter for Speed

Australian‑based players are protected by the Interactive Gambling Act 2001, but most online casinos operating for Australians are actually licensed offshore – in Malta, Gibraltar or Curacao. A reputable licence means the operator must follow strict anti‑money‑laundering (AML) procedures, which can affect withdrawal speed.

Sites holding an Australian licence (e.g., those regulated by the Northern Territory) tend to have faster local payout pathways because they work directly with Australian banks. However, they are fewer in number and often have higher wagering requirements on bonuses. Always check the licence details in the site’s footer; it’s a quick way to gauge whether “instant payouts” are realistic.

Step‑by‑Step: How to Ensure the Quickest Withdrawal

  1. Complete verification early. Upload a clear scan of your driver’s licence or passport, plus a utility bill, before you make your first deposit.
  2. Choose a fast payment method. Set up POLi, PayPal or an e‑wallet in your casino account settings.
  3. Keep your account balance above the minimum withdrawal amount. Some casinos won’t process a request under AU$20, which can cause unnecessary delays.
  4. Submit the withdrawal request during business hours. Even “instant” systems need a human check if something looks odd.
  5. Watch for bonus clearance. If you have an active welcome bonus, the casino may hold the payout until wagering requirements are met.

Follow those five steps and you’ll be in the “instant” zone for most Australian‑friendly sites. The key is preparation – the faster you’re verified and the more you align with the casino’s preferred payout method, the less time you’ll waste.

Common Pitfalls That Slow Down Your Cash‑out

  • Incomplete KYC documents. A blurry scan or missing address proof sends the request back for review.
  • Using a payment method not supported for withdrawals. Some casinos let you deposit with PayPal but only pay out to a bank account.
  • Pending bonus wagering. The casino will freeze the cash‑out until you meet the required playthrough.
  • High‑risk jurisdictions. Playing at an unlicensed offshore operator often means you’ll wait days for a manual review.
  • Weekend or public holiday processing. Even “instant” systems can be slowed by banking holidays.

Spotting these red flags early saves you from the dreaded “withdrawal pending” email that arrives at 3 am. A quick check of the casino’s FAQ page usually tells you which payment methods are fastest and what documents are required.

Mobile Apps vs Desktop – Does Platform Affect Speed?

Most modern Australian casinos offer a responsive website and a native iOS/Android app. The withdrawal speed is generally the same across platforms because the request is processed on the back‑end server, not on your device.

That said, the app can sometimes give you push notifications when a payout is approved, letting you know instantly that the money is on its way. Also, a well‑designed mobile interface may make it easier to upload verification documents straight from your phone camera, cutting down on the back‑and‑forth email chain.

Responsible Gambling and Instant Payouts – Staying Safe

Speed is great, but it should never override responsible gambling practices. If you can cash out in minutes, you might be tempted to chase losses more aggressively. Look for casinos that provide self‑exclusion tools, deposit limits and clear information on gambling‑help organisations.

Australian players can reach the national helpline (1800 212 733) for free, 24/7 support. Many reputable sites also link directly to the Australian Gambling Help Network in their footer – a good sign they take player welfare seriously, even if they advertise “instant withdrawals”.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I really get an instant payout with a credit card?
Usually not. Credit card withdrawals often take 1‑24 hours because the card issuer needs to authorise the transaction.
Do I need to verify my identity for every withdrawal?
Only the first time. After your account is fully verified, subsequent withdrawals are processed automatically, unless the casino flags a large amount.
Is there a limit on how much I can withdraw instantly?
Most sites set a daily or weekly cap for “instant” methods – often AU$1,000 to AU$2,000. Larger sums may be routed via bank transfer and take longer.
